Well they had tunes for all 1.8 TSis, but they had to hook up the car to see if SPS capability was available, but now they are saying that they don't even have a tune and is in the development stages for my particular car. My car has a built date of 07/15 so it is an early model 16 , but they even let the shop hanging as shop had to make multiple calls to Revo USA to figure out what the hell was going on.
